Although the hall porter saw someone's carriage standing at the
entrance, after scrutinizing the mother and son (who without
asking to be announced had passed straight through the glass
porch between the rows of statues in niches) and looking
significantly at the lady's old cloak, he asked whether they
wanted the count or the princesses, and, hearing that they wished
to see the count, said his excellency was worse today, and that
his excellency was not receiving anyone.
"We may as well go back," said the son in French.
"My dear!" exclaimed his mother imploringly, again laying her
hand on his arm as if that touch might soothe or rouse him.
Boris said no more, but looked inquiringly at his mother without
taking off his cloak.
